> ## Documentation Index
> Fetch the complete documentation index at: https://docs.omni.co/llms.txt
> Use this file to discover all available pages before exploring further.

<AgentInstructions>

## Submitting Feedback

If you encounter incorrect, outdated, or confusing documentation on this page, submit feedback:

POST https://docs.omni.co/feedback

```json
{
  "path": "/demos/2025/20250703",
  "feedback": "Description of the issue"
}
```

Only submit feedback when you have something specific and actionable to report.

</AgentInstructions>

# July 3, 2025

> Fill Gaps in Any Date Series, More AI Auto-Modeling, More Model Permissions, and More

<Note>
  **Stay in the loop!** Subscribe to the [demo RSS feed](/demos/rss.xml) to be notified when we post new demos.

  Demos highlight what we are working on or experimenting with, but are not a guarantee of release. Let us know your thoughts at [support@omni.co](mailto:support@omni.co).
</Note>

## Fill gaps in any date series

*Cathy Lennon · `Workbook`*

Now any time-series can dynamically fill missing dates between the min and max in the data set.

<Frame>
  <iframe src="https://www.youtube.com/embed/2rzHT7gYtSU"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## More automated modeling from AI

*Steven Talbot · `Modeling` `Ai`*

Our auto-modeler from AI sessions is getting smarter. UI has been tuned up and precision also much better.

<Frame>
  <iframe src="https://www.youtube.com/embed/70gdut2v7lU"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Automated topic descriptions from usage

*Jamie Davidson · `Ai` `Modeling`*

More AI context from using Omni. This time, we're opening up topic descriptions to guide use cases on different data sets based on real usage.

<Frame>
  <iframe src="https://www.youtube.com/embed/vLeE_a23IyQ"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Topic restriction for AI query

*Steven Talbot · `Ai` `Modeling`*

We added a new model argument for curating the data sets allowed for AI query.

<Frame>
  <iframe src="https://www.youtube.com/embed/ZR-eE_E1aQY"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Internal AI query discussion (how to AI model)

*Colin Zima · `Ai` `Use Case` `Internal`*

Some discussion about how we've implemented AI context for internal usage and tuning process.

<Frame>
  <iframe src="https://www.youtube.com/embed/_K8WNjUStwI"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Model level permissions

*Conrad Slimmer · `Administration` `Permissions`*

Adding a new permissions layer to control model extensions, allowing more complex use cases with team or group models.

<Frame>
  <iframe src="https://www.youtube.com/embed/OMseLGi9HWY"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Bunch of dbt improvements

*Buck Ryan · `Dbt` `Administration`*

Bunch of improvements to the dbt experience - better metadata syncing / dbt health and more flexible SSH key management.

<Frame>
  <iframe src="https://www.youtube.com/embed/afAaNaQVXXI"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Streaming pivot export

*Jonathan Swenson · `Export` `Downloads`*

We made it so pivots now also stream for exports, meaning no limit even for pivoted queries for downloads.

<Frame>
  <iframe src="https://www.youtube.com/embed/bvQ7Y14zSEQ"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Chart type swapper pattern

*Colin Zima · `Use Case` `Modeling Pattern` `Workbook` `Dashboards` `Visualization`*

A quick modeling pattern for dynamically swapping the chart type with a filter.

<Frame>
  <iframe src="https://www.youtube.com/embed/nPq41rrZZvY"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## LookML to Omni converter API app

*Justin He · `Mini App` `Modeling`*

Another vibe coded app on top of the Omni API - this one for converting LookML to Omni's data model.

<Frame>
  <iframe src="https://www.youtube.com/embed/ZKxugnoZRmE"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>

## Better invite flow

*Sarah Waterson · `Administration`*

Little bit of tuning the invite flow to allow better bulk user invitations.

<Frame>
  <iframe src="https://www.youtube.com/embed/7m6LR8agQYA" width="100%" height="400"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ture" allowFullScreen />
</Frame>
